From fe6aaef20607de75cebfab05b2daa750016557d4 Mon Sep 17 00:00:00 2001 From: Shariq Ansari Date: Mon, 20 Nov 2023 15:22:00 +0530 Subject: [PATCH] fix: show contact details with option to switch to edit mode --- crm/api/session.py | 3 + .../src/components/Modals/ContactModal.vue | 280 +++++++++++++----- frontend/src/pages/Contact.vue | 27 +- 3 files changed, 233 insertions(+), 77 deletions(-) diff --git a/crm/api/session.py b/crm/api/session.py index 2b7e2d07..0bc64db9 100644 --- a/crm/api/session.py +++ b/crm/api/session.py @@ -31,6 +31,9 @@ def get_contacts(): "first_name", "last_name", "full_name", + "gender", + "address", + "designation", "image", "email_id", "mobile_no", diff --git a/frontend/src/components/Modals/ContactModal.vue b/frontend/src/components/Modals/ContactModal.vue index 9de9fff0..fdd1c669 100644 --- a/frontend/src/components/Modals/ContactModal.vue +++ b/frontend/src/components/Modals/ContactModal.vue @@ -1,73 +1,133 @@